Lady Yotes Score Four in Win Over Warner Pacific

Sarah Hicks scored the Yotes first goal in today's win over WP
CALDWELL, Idaho – A dominant first 45 minutes by The College of Idaho helped the Lady Yotes move above the .500 mark in Cascade Conference play, stopping Warner Pacific, 4-1, at Simplot Stadium.

The Yotes (4-5-1, 3-2 CCC) used a three goal barrage in a four minute span late in the opening period to build a 4-0 lead, with the squad emptying their bench in the second half.
 
The C of I got on the board in the eighth minute, as Jessica Ayala touched a great through-ball to the streaking Sarah Hicks, who beat WP (1-10, 0-4) keeper Lynzee Felder to the far post for a 1-0 lead.  After a trio of near misses, the Yote reserves strung together an impressive run – starting in the 37th minute.  Sydney Woods collected the rebound of a Brianna Strodtbeck shot outside the box and looped a left-footed shot over Felder for a 2-0 lead.
 
Just 33 seconds later, Brittney Lacey played a cross into the middle of the area, finding Mekenzie Messick, who flicked a ball into the twice for a 3-0 lead.  Three minutes later, Strodtbeck played a ball to Brianna Blair at the top of the 18, looping a shot over Felder’s head to complete the run – as the Yotes held a commanding 13-1 edge in first half shots.
 
The Knights picked up the tempo in the second half – getting on the board in the 53rd minute, as Anna Blakeslee collected a loose ball a step inside the box and one-timed a shot into the right corner of the net.  WP would control the tempo for the next 20 minutes, but could not crack the Yote defense.
 
The C of I held a 15-10 edge in total shots, while the Knights had a 6-5 edge in corner kicks.
 
The Lady Yotes return to action next weekend with key road tilts at Evergreen and Northwest.
